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of the affected area and contain the spill to prevent further damage.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ract sewage and prevent it from seeping into surrounding areas.

Step 2: Sewage Extraction

We’ll use industrial-strength pumps and vacuums to extract sewage from your property. Our team will work efficiently to reduce the disruption to your daily life.

Step 3: Disinfection and Decontamination

We’ll use advanced disinfection techniques to remove b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ms that can cause health issues. Our team will also decontaminate personal protective equipment (PPE) and other items.

Step 4: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area and remove any remaining moisture.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a safe environment.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is safe and healthy. We’ll also clean and disinfect any areas that need attention.

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ection Cost in Frederick, MD

Prices vary based on the severity of the spill,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for various services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Sewage Extraction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and severity of spill
Disinfection and Decontamination $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and type of disinfection required
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ment required
Final Inspection and C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of cleaning required
Insurance Claims and Paperwork No more fee Our team will handle the claims process for you.
